Overview and Classification

Leptodactylus is a genus that encompasses a variety of true frogs, with approximately 40 recognized species. It is classified under the order Anura, which encompasses all frogs and toads, and the family Leptodactylidae. This genus is characterized by its diverse morphological traits, ecological niches, and reproductive strategies, which allow them to thrive in different environments.

The classification of Leptodactylus can be broken down as follows:

  • Kingdom: Animalia
  • Phylum: Chordata
  • Class: Amphibia
  • Order: Anura
  • Family: Leptodactylidae
  • Genus: Leptodactylus
  • Within this genus, species vary greatly in size, color, and habitat preferences, making them a compelling subject for herpetologists and wildlife enthusiasts alike.

    Physical Characteristics

    Species within the Leptodactylus genus exhibit a range of physical traits, often adapting their morphology to their specific environments. Generally, they possess elongated bodies with a smooth or granular skin texture. Common characteristics include:

  • Size: Adult Leptodactylus frogs typically range from 5 to 10 centimeters in length, although some species can grow larger.
  • Coloration: Their coloration varies widely, with some species displaying vibrant hues and patterns, while others are more subdued, providing effective camouflage in their natural habitats.
  • Limbs: They have long, slender limbs adapted for jumping and swimming, with webbed feet that aid in movement through aquatic environments.
  • Eyes: Prominent, bulging eyes are common, providing excellent vision for spotting prey and potential predators.
  • These physical attributes not only enhance their survival in diverse environments but also play a role in their mating behaviors and interactions with other species.

    Habitat and Distribution

    Leptodactylus species are predominantly found in tropical and subtropical regions of Central and South America. Their habitats are diverse, ranging from moist forests and grasslands to wetlands and savannas. Some species are even adapted to live in arid regions.

    The geographical distribution of Leptodactylus extends from southern United States to parts of Argentina, demonstrating their adaptability to various climates and ecological conditions. Key habitats include:

  • Rainforests: Dense foliage provides shelter and breeding grounds, with abundant food sources.
  • Swamps and Marshes: Aquatic environments are crucial for reproduction, as many species lay their eggs in still water.
  • Grasslands: Open areas provide foraging opportunities while still allowing access to moisture.
  • The adaptability of Leptodactylus to various habitats underscores their ecological significance and resilience.

    Behaviour

    Leptodactylus frogs display a range of behaviors that facilitate their survival and reproduction. Their behavioral patterns can be categorized into several key areas:

  • Activity Patterns: Many species are nocturnal, emerging at night to hunt for food and engage in mating rituals. This behavior helps them avoid daytime predators and conserve moisture.
  • Communication: Vocalizations play a crucial role in mating. Males produce distinctive calls to attract females, often engaging in complex vocal displays that can vary significantly among species.
  • Territoriality: Males often exhibit territorial behavior, defending their calling sites from rival males to ensure mating success.
  • Parental Care: Some species exhibit unique parental behaviors, such as guarding eggs or transporting tadpoles to water sources, which increases offspring survival rates.
  • These behaviors not only reflect the adaptability of Leptodactylus but also highlight their intricate social interactions.

    Diet

    Leptodactylus species are primarily insectivorous, feeding on a diverse diet that includes various invertebrates. Their diet typically consists of:

  • Insects: Ants, beetles, and moths are commonly consumed.
  • Arachnids: Spiders and other arachnids can also be part of their diet.
  • Other Invertebrates: Depending on availability, they may consume worms and slugs.
  • Their hunting strategy often involves ambush tactics, where they remain still and blend into their environment before striking at passing prey. The diet of Leptodactylus is crucial for maintaining ecological balance in their habitats, as they help control insect populations.

    Reproduction and Lifespan

    Reproductive strategies among Leptodactylus species are diverse and often adapted to their specific environments. Key aspects of their reproduction include:

  • Breeding Seasons: Many species breed during the rainy season when water sources are plentiful, ensuring a suitable environment for egg development.
  • Egg Laying: Females typically lay eggs in water or moist environments. The number of eggs can vary from a few dozen to several hundred, depending on the species.
  • Tadpole Development: After fertilization, eggs hatch into tadpoles. The tadpole stage can last from several weeks to months, depending on the species and environmental conditions.
  • Metamorphosis: Tadpoles undergo metamorphosis, transitioning into adult frogs. This process is influenced by environmental factors such as temperature and food availability.
  • The lifespan of Leptodactylus species varies, with many living around 4 to 10 years in the wild, although some individuals may survive longer under optimal conditions.

    Predators and Threats

    As with many amphibians, Leptodactylus species face numerous threats in their natural habitats. Common predators include:

  • Birds: Many bird species prey on frogs and tadpoles.
  • Snakes: Various snake species are known to hunt frogs.
  • Mammals: Small mammals, such as raccoons and some primates, may also pose threats.
  • Additionally, Leptodactylus faces significant threats from human activities, including habitat destruction due to deforestation, pollution, and climate change. These factors contribute to population declines and pose challenges for their survival.

    Conservation Status

    The conservation status of Leptodactylus species varies, with some being classified as threatened or near threatened due to habitat loss and environmental changes. Organizations such as the International Union for Conservation of Nature (IUCN) monitor these species, advocating for conservation efforts to protect their habitats and promote biodiversity.

    Conservation actions may include habitat restoration, legal protection of critical areas, and public awareness campaigns to educate communities about the importance of amphibians in ecosystems.
